More about the interim manager

The interim manager is an experienced senior executive with a particular focus on sustainable success through the development and optimization of international sales structures. As an interim CEO and in similar roles, he develops and manages the realignment or restructuring of medium-sized companies.

In his 25-year career as a C-level manager in corporations and medium-sized companies, the interim manager has built up an international network in more than 50 countries on all continents. He is happy to use this network for his clients, for example when opening up new markets, developing product innovations or making make-or-buy decisions at home and abroad.

In addition to medium and long-term realignment, the interim manager is also highly skilled at providing companies with the necessary leeway in crisis situations through effective immediate measures. In his experience, sales play a key role in this. With his hands-on mentality, he actively develops key accounts in order to expand volume with existing customers and generate new business.

The interim manager has a degree in engineering. With this technical background and his commercial experience, he bases his analyses and decisions on reliable key figures. It goes without saying that he is familiar with the latest digital tools for transparency, communication and improving customer relationships and business processes.

In his numerous international projects, the interim manager has acquired strong social and intercultural skills. He knows how to form efficient teams across company and national borders and lead them to success.

He also impresses with his authentic manner and pragmatism. He is able to reduce complex relationships to simple denominators.

His motto: Words are cheap, actions are everything!
